What is a Mesothelioma Lawsuit?
A Mesothelioma Litigation lawsuit is a legal claim filed by an individual identified with mesothelioma versus those responsible for their asbestos direct exposure. This could consist of makers of asbestos items, employers, or other celebrations who added to the direct exposure. The primary goal of these claims is to look for compensation for medical costs, lost earnings, discomfort and suffering, and other damages.

Browsing the legal landscape can be difficult, but comprehending the basic process can help clients and families prepare. The list below steps describe the normal progression of a Mesothelioma Lawsuit Compensation Types lawsuit:
Consultation with Legal Experts: Patients ought to talk to lawyers who specialize in mesothelioma cases. This step is important for comprehending the viability of their case and the potential for settlement.
Gathering Evidence: Legal agents will help gather medical records, employment history, and evidence of asbestos exposure.
Filing the Lawsuit: Once sufficient proof is gathered, the lawsuit is filed in a court that has jurisdiction over asbestos cases.
Discovery Process: Both celebrations exchange evidence and information pertinent to the case. This stage might include depositions, where witnesses are questioned under oath.
Settlement and Settlement: Most cases are settled before going to trial, either through negotiation between the parties or mediation.
Trial (if suitable): If a settlement can not be reached, the case proceeds to trial, where a judge or jury will make a ruling.
Awarding Damages: If the plaintiff wins, they will be awarded compensation, which the accused should pay.

How long do I need to submit a mesothelioma lawsuit?
The statute of restrictions for submitting a mesothelioma lawsuit varies by state, typically ranging from 1 to 3 years after medical diagnosis or death.
2. How much does it cost to file a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Many mesothelioma lawyers deal with a contingency cost basis, indicating they just make money if the case is successful. Initial consultations are usually free.
3. What kinds of settlement can I get?
Victims can look for compensation for medical costs, lost earnings, pain and suffering, and sometimes compensatory damages if the defendant acted with gross negligence.
4. Is it necessary to go to trial for a mesothelioma lawsuit?
No, many mesothelioma cases are settled out of court. A settlement can save time and provide quicker payment.
5. Can relative submit a lawsuit if the patient has died?
Yes, member of the family can file a wrongful death lawsuit on behalf of the deceased if they can show that asbestos direct exposure resulted in their enjoyed one's death.
